I am currently trying to make a very cool subclass for barbarian but for some reason I can’t charge it. D&D beyond says something like this:
This Subclass cannot be shared with the community for the following reasons:
This homebrew Subclass does not have the necessary class features with the correct required levels.
Remember, private homebrew is automatically shared with other users in your campaigns and does not need to be shared with the community for players to access.
I do have the necessary class features for different levels being a 3rd, 6th, 10th, and 14th level class features which is the levels the subclasses for barbarian have. Also it says I can’t charge because the subclass is too much like circle of spores, but it’s entirely different.
But please don’t publish it right away. Take a few months to playtest it and edit it. Clean up the spelling/punctuation. Reword things you’ll find need a revision in a few weeks. Add/adjust/tweak class features and their associated actions and modifiers. Make sure it’s 1,000% perfect before you publish it. Because once it’s published, you cannot edit it any further without creating a new version and republishing it which will leave ghosts of the old versions that will haunt your homebrewer forever. Save yourself the headache and hold off on publishing your homebrew until it’s really, really ready.
